Handover note — pricing, Corvale line

Hi Mira — taking over from me on Corvale pricing, here's where things stand. We repriced the base tier in the spring and it held up better than expected; churn stayed flat. The premium tier is still underpriced against Dunmore Systems, and I'd nudge it up 4–5% before the autumn cycle. Finance has the elasticity workbook; lean on Tobin for the modelling. One thing you'll need before the board session is the context below.

confidential, bahof-yaweg: Headcount on the Kaseth team goes from 32 to 109 by the end of January. Gross margin on Kaseth came in at 46 percent against a plan of 45 percent.

### Request tracing across services

Every request that enters the Lanternmesh gateway gets a trace ID stamped into the `X-Lantern-Trace` header, and each downstream hop (pricing, inventory, notifications) appends its own span. If a customer reports a stuck order, grab the trace ID from their receipt payload and plug it into the trace search endpoint — it'll show you exactly which hop ate the request. Note the trace API is read-only but still gated; authenticate your lookup calls with the token below.

session JWT of yawep-yawep = eyJhbGciOiJIUzI1NiIsInR5cCI6IkpXVCJ9.eyJzdWIiOiI3pWF3_In0.aXYsHiog

Crashlane plugins receive crash reports after dedup and symbolication. Your plugin runs in a sandboxed worker; exceed the time budget and the report is requeued without you. Payloads above the size cap arrive truncated with a flag set. Batches are ordered by severity, not arrival. Do not assume retries are rare — design handlers to be idempotent. Rate limits apply per plugin, not per app, so noisy tenants can starve you. The limits you must design against are:

tuning table, yajog-yahof:
BUDGETS = {
    "lamvan": 303,
    "wenox": 460,
    "fenvan": 525,
}

DIAG-208: Undo/redo history blob fails signature check

So SketchLattice signs its undo/redo history blobs so a corrupted stack can't replay garbage edits into a diagram. After the 3.2 refactor, redo entries get serialized with the old schema but signed with the new routine, so verification fails and users lose their redo stack. Maintainers: fix the serializer first, then regenerate test fixtures. All fixtures must be re-signed with the current key, shown below.

release key, hadug-kawef: bky13_mPGeFZeR1GZ1G